**09:41** — Clarion clinic reminder job failed mid-run; roughly 1,800 of 5,200 appointment reminders unsent. Root cause: template service returned malformed payloads after its 09:30 deploy, and the job aborted instead of skipping. Mitigation: rolled template service back at 09:55, re-ran job with dedupe flag at 10:03. No duplicate messages sent. Remaining reminders delivered by 10:20. The failing job run is identified by the trace token below.

pipeline stamp: htk31_f769b577b3028a4e9958e5bb8d1259a

Ticket #GLOT-armless — Vault locked, SQL lint config unreachable

Hey on-call — the Quillstone vault that holds our shared SQL linting rules sealed itself after three bad unlock attempts, so CI is skipping the sqlcheck stage entirely. Merges are piling up. Please reseal-override via the admin console and re-enable the ruleset. Use the recovery passphrase given below.

strongbox words: norwyn-wenael-aldvan-aldiel-wendor-holael

**Ticket FV-2281: Connection failures during checkout load test**

Load test against the Bramblepay checkout flow fails past 400 concurrent users. Pool exhaustion — checkout holds a connection across the inventory call. Fix in this PR: release before the call, reacquire after. Please verify no transaction spans the gap. To reproduce, run `loadgen --profile checkout` against staging, which uses the database at the connection string below.

replica DSN, kajep-yahag: mssql://praok_svc:iF@db-8d68.plorvaio.local:5432/eliion

Finance Review Summary — Q2

Quick summary for the board: the hiring freeze in the Larkspur Instruments division has held since March and is doing its job. Payroll in that unit is down 7%, and attrition backfills are being absorbed by the Dunmore team without much pain. Morale surveys dipped slightly, nothing alarming. We'd suggest keeping the freeze through year-end and revisiting in January. One sensitive point for the board only sits below.

board note of baweg-bawig: Project Tamath slips by six weeks because of the audit delay.